In this uncertain economic climate, making the right decision at the right time has never been more important for corporate success – or even survival. But many large organisations are so awash with data that delivering meaningful information on business performance to senior executives is a huge challenge.
Firms need to be able to understand information, and use that effectively to get employees working together and focused on their key objectives. For IT leaders, delivering the technology needed to organise and interpret the reams of data available is central to their role in achieving corporate success.
A Computing web seminar, in association with IBM, examined the tools, technologies and best practices that help ensure your organisation is using information effectively and profitably. Our panel of experts answered viewer's questions on this important topic.
